January

Weather in January

January, the same as December, is another warm summer month in Laudium, South Africa, with temperature in the range of an average low of 17.7°C (63.9°F) and an average high of 28.7°C (83.7°F).

Temperature

January stands out as Laudium's warmest month, with an average high-temperature of 28.7°C (83.7°F) and a low-temperature of 17.7°C (63.9°F).

Heat index

In January, the heat index is estimated at a hot 31°C (87.8°F). If one sustains activity during exposure, it could lead to a sense of fatigue, with a chance of heat cramps.
Research indicates the heat index considers values in shaded locales and with light winds. Exposure to direct sunshine can increase heat index values by up to 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'felt air temperature' or 'apparent temperature', represents the fusion of temperature and moisture in the air to suggest how warm it feels. This effect is personal, shaped by the individual's physical activity and heat sensitivity, influenced by factors including wind, clothing, and metabolic variances. Taking into account that direct sunlight can boost the heat effect, the heat index may rise by up to 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are quite important for babies and toddlers. Children often overlook the necessity for resting and fluid replenishment. Thirst is a late sign of dehydration - thus, it is critical to stay hydrated, especially during extended periods of physical activities.

Humidity

The months with the highest humidity in Laudium are January and February, with an average relative humidity of 62%.

Rainfall

January is the month with the most rainfall. Rain falls for 20.5 days and accumulates 82mm (3.23") of precipitation.

Daylight

The average length of the day in January is 13h and 32min.
On the first day of the month, sunrise is at 05:19 and sunset at 19:02. On the last day of January, sunrise is at 05:41 and sunset at 18:59 SAST.

Sunshine

The average sunshine in January in Laudium is 11.5h.

UV index

January through March, October through December, with an average maximum UV index of 6, are months with the highest UV index. A UV Index reading of 6 to 7 represents a high health risk from unprotected exposure to Sun's UV rays for ordinary individuals.
Note: The maximum daily UV index of 6 during January translates into the following directions:
Persist with precautions and heed sun safety advice. Prevention of sunburn is compulsory. Seek shade and limit direct sun exposure between 10 a.m. and 4 p.m., the peak period for UV radiation. Keep in mind that shade structures like parasols or canopies do not offer complete sun protection. Your best bet for sun defense on the face, eyes, and neck is a hat with a wide brim.
